  1. Right of Withdrawal

The Buyer has the right to withdraw from the goods within 14 calendar days from the moment of receiving the Goods. (Depending on the product, the buyer may not have mandatory withdrawal rights; in such a case, the reason must be clearly stated and explained). The right of withdrawal is not applicable if the Buyer is a legal entity.

To exercise the 14-day right of withdrawal, the goods may only be used for their intended purposes, the consumer is responsible for maintaining the quality and safety of the goods during the period of exercising the right of withdrawal. If the goods are used improperly or damaged, if used carelessly during use or not following instructions, if the original packaging of the goods is lost, or if its packaging is significantly damaged, the online store has the right to reduce the refund amount in accordance with the decrease in the value of the goods.

To exercise the right of withdrawal, you must submit a withdrawal form, which can be found here: withdrawal form by sending it to the email address otilie@otilie.lv within 14 days after receiving the goods.

The Buyer covers the costs of returning the goods, except in cases where the reason for return is that the goods do not comply with the order (e.g., incorrect or damaged product).

The Buyer is obliged to return the Goods to the Seller without delay, but no later than 14 days after sending the withdrawal form to the online store. After receiving the returned goods, the online store will promptly, but no later than within 14 days, refund all payments received from the buyer based on the Distance Contract.

The Seller has the right to withhold payment until the Goods or proof of return of the goods has been received from the Buyer.   1. Consumer Rights for Non-Conforming Goods

The online store is responsible for non-conformities of goods sold to the Buyer with the contract terms or defects that arose within 6 months after the delivery date to the customer, or were present at the time of delivery, if such an assumption does not contradict the characteristics of the item or the defect. The Buyer must inform the Seller about non-conformity of goods immediately, within 2 months after discovering it, i.e., submit a complaint. The Buyer can submit a complaint by contacting the online store, writing to otilie@otilie.lv

The online store is not responsible for defects that arose after the delivery of goods to the Buyer. If the purchased goods have defects for which the Seller is responsible, the Buyer has the right to demand the elimination of the defects or exchange for new goods free of charge.

If the goods cannot be repaired or replaced, the Seller refunds all payments provided for in the Distance Contract to the Buyer. The Seller provides a written response to the consumer's complaint within 15 days.
